No.4 has carried the following liveries:
1921-1951 Corris Maroon (Was owned by the GWR 1923-48 and BR 48-51 but was not repainted)
1951-1983 Talyllyn Dark Green, various shades, for 9 years in the 60's/70's with a Geisel Ejector funnel. (Fitted with a brass band at one point)
1984 GWR Brunswick green with G W R lettering on the sides of the tanks.
1984-2000 Peter Sam livery, apart from a breif period when it went back into Corris Maroon in 1994 (nicknamed the flying Mars Bar at the time!)
2001 (Jan-March) BR black with BR emblem on the tank, to see what it would look like if BR had bothered to repaint the Corris stock in 1948.
On its return to steam, it may spend a couple of months in BR black for all those who missed it the 1st time, and then will probably go into Talyllyn Green for a nice change since No.6 Douglas is now the Thomas engine!
